你查询的IP:[218.19.58.95]  地理位置:中国–广东–广州–天河区

最新查询119.10.56.41 202.90.58.49 124.16.70.59 210.76.67.23 119.8.47.139 117.44.36.30 120.64.86.24 210.15.27.16 122.8.106.1 218.19.58.95 221.208.208.224 210.22.122.155 222.248.136.109 125.62.29.83 122.96.148.68 202.141.160.90 123.108.208.70 119.18.208.254 119.18.208.110 122.88.64.173 121.204.222.114 203.86.64.157 192.188.170.231 221.192.4.150 61.47.128.185 125.171.22.254 222.160.255.220 114.64.3.0 123.137.91.17 122.156.48.248 202.4.128.254